摘要
In the last few years, the remarkable increase of containerized trade and the resulting increase in congestion and operating costs of container terminals have indicated the importance of integrated management of port resources. This research investigates an integrated decision problem that deals with the simultaneous optimization of berth allocation, tugboat and quay crane assignment. The main contributions of the work are the integrated simulation modelling of port resource allocation problem and proposing an effective evolutionary path re-linking algorithm to find a globally good solution for the problem. The effectiveness of the proposed evolutionary algorithm is tested on RAJAEE Port as a real case. The result demonstrates the effectiveness of the proposed simulation-based optimization approach to find the near optimal solution within a reasonable time. The simulation experiment shows that the objective function value is affected significantly by the arrival disruptions and it is not sensitive to the variations of berth operation time.
